Hello there, I'm new to this site and have a 7-year old Bombay and just adopted a young kitten :)

Technically, we are only fostering the 7yo for a friend of a friend who left the country in November of 2017. My wife and I live in a large house with a nice patio where the cat has tons of room to roam and play, and she's grown quite attached to us.

The original owner adopted her in November 2014 and said she wants to come back and reclaim her in September of 2021. We asked her about the possibility of just adopting her permanently, but she said she definitely wants her back.

My wife and I have no intentions of actually sending her back to the original owner after taking care of her for almost 4 years and approximately half of her lifetime. Is this legit, or wrong of us? I don't think the cat would be happy having to resettle after all this time.

From the point of view of the cat's best interest, I'm with you! It could get tricky under the law. Is the cat registered, and is the former owner's name on the registry? Has she been sending money to you for ALL upkeep, including vet bills, food, furnishings, etc? If she has not, if you have been providing everything for this cat, then in MANY places, the cat would be legally considered to have been abandoned to you, and you are the legal owners now. I'd talk to someone familiar with animal ownership laws in your area, and get any needed proof of ownership gathered well before she comes back to try to claim the cat.
